Just as a FYI most OS's will downclock the cpu when they are not busy as well as ramping down the fans to reduce the power usage. If you throw Folding at the cpu though that will generate both power usage and probably a fair bit of heat which in turn makes the office a nightmare. In all honesty I would expect you're mean time to failure to go down due to the extended permanent load when idle.

As much as folding etc is good, heat and power savings are better currently generally.

It's for a good cause but do it with your own kit and money, not the school's. It has hidden costs through power plus wear and tear, imagine the head finding out it is costing more for the school and unauthorised! Similar to Bitcoin mining with school machines (except that comes with a whole host of other legal hassles making it a terrible idea!).
